Chapter 90: A Contingency Plan

The carriage curtain fluttered in the wind, swaying.

Before my eyes, Dou Ya seemed to be shrouded in dark clouds.

Eighteen Slopes, flowers bloomed by human blood, could be lively.

He had walked through a hail of blades, a seasoned warrior, an all-powerful Eunuch.

He glanced at Qin Mingxu and said, “Go back with my Elder Sister.”

Not far away, Qin Mingxu, though heavily wounded, showed no intention of retreating.

“Director Feng risked himself for my wife, how could I flee?”

I leaned on the carriage door and looked at him. He shook his head at me resolutely.

I knew his mind was made up.

The coachman urged the horses with all his might, cracking the whip. The carriage began to move.

“Dou Ya, Mingxu, I’ll wait for you to return—”

The valley stretched my voice thin and broken.

Eighteen Slopes receded into the distance.

Through the clouds and mist, it was difficult to see.

I retreated into the carriage and sat down.

Cherry nestled beside me and said, “Yu Niang, don’t worry.”

I hugged her, looking at her bloody little hands, and said softly, “It will be alright once we get home.”

She nodded obediently.

Half an hour later, the carriage stopped before the Qin Manor gate.

I entered with Cherry and ordered the servants to call for a doctor.

Before long, the doctor arrived, applied medicine to Cherry, and bandaged her wounds. I carried her to the bed. She was exhausted and fell asleep the moment her head touched the pillow. Before sleeping, she held my hand. In her sleep, she shivered. Like a small animal lacking security.

After all, she was just a Child. The bloody scene tonight must have greatly frightened her.

I gently patted her back, comforting her.

The climbing vines had not yet withered, entwined. I leaned on the pillow, counting the hours. What was the situation on Shenju Mountain now? When would they return?

Several times the wind made the door creak softly. I got out of bed barefoot and went to the door, looking out.

There was nothing but the vast night.

Over there, Feng Gao engaged in a fierce battle, screams echoing in a continuous stream.

He had learned martial arts from Eunuch Cao since childhood. His skills were extraordinary. His movements were like fleeting shadows, each step a killing blow.

Zou Cheng’s rabble were either dead or wounded.

He fled in terror towards the dense forest.

Feng Gao leaped up, his hands like eagle claws gripping him.

“Do you think you can leave tonight?”

The moon had completely disappeared behind the clouds.

It was pitch black all around.

Zou Cheng could not clearly see the expression on Feng Gao’s face. He said with disgust and fear, “Feng Gao, you demon! It was you who instigated Qin Mingxu to impersonate Minister Zhang’s son at the Zhang Manor! You harm loyal officials! You will not have a good end! Those who do much injustice will perish by their own hand!”

Feng Gao had always harbored resentment over Minister Zhang’s death.

Everyone in The World believed Minister Zhang died by his hand.

This had become the greatest stain on him.

But at this moment, he disdained to explain to Zou Cheng.

The moment Zou Cheng laid a hand on Elder Sister, in his heart, Zou Cheng was no different from a dead man.

The blade in his sleeve was about to be released.

Zou Cheng suddenly shouted, “Feng Gao, you care so much about Zhu Sangyu, have you thought about her family being destroyed?”

Feng Gao stopped.

Zou Cheng pointed at Qin Mingxu beside him and said, “I have already handed the Evidence of this man murdering the Troupe Leader to my confidant. Tonight, if I die here, tomorrow, the Petition will immediately appear at the Government Office!”

Qin Mingxu lowered his head. Zou Cheng had made preparations and had no intention of letting him off the hook.

Feng Gao said coldly, “Even if I turn Yangzhou City upside down, I will find that person.”

Zou Cheng said with finality, “You won’t find him. It’s impossible to find him.”

He seemed to have grasped the trump card.

His certainty made Feng Gao hesitate slightly. Could Zou Cheng’s confidant be someone from the Government Office?

Zou Cheng sneered, “Director Feng, your deep affection is wasted on being an Eunuch.”

That sentence was like a snake hidden deep within, colorful and sticky, slithering towards Feng Gao’s heart.

Many things in this world have no discernible cause and cannot withstand deep scrutiny.

His broken body could not be mended.

He would never be able to become a normal man.

Deep affection.

Did these two words have anything to do with him?

He was merely a Younger Brother, hiding behind the screen of family affection to protect her.

Qin Mingxu seemed to have made a great decision and said, “Let him expose it. At this point, I am no longer afraid. Whatever happens, happens. I accept it. I only beg Director…”

He paused, “I only beg Director to take care of Sang Yu and the Child.”

As soon as the words left his mouth, he felt a sudden sense of relief.

The stone that had been pressing on his back for so long seemed to have been removed.

Why endure being controlled?

A man dares to act and dares to take responsibility.

He had returned to being the carefree and unrestrained Young Master Qin he once was.

Whether to kill or to torture, he would face it all.

Feng Gao, however, said sternly, “No. You cannot be harmed. Elder Sister is waiting for you at home.”

As they argued, there was a rustling sound from the nearby bushes. Zou Cheng rejoiced and suddenly broke free from Feng Gao’s grasp. Several masked men flew out from the bushes, grabbed Zou Cheng, and fled.

Feng Gao thought for a moment, beckoned a Guard, and whispered a few words in his ear. The Guard moved lightly and followed in the direction of the masked men and Zou Cheng.

Feng Gao instructed him to follow Zou Cheng closely, trace the clues, find the Evidence, and destroy it.

This was the most reliable method.

It could protect Qin Mingxu.

Having done all this, he said calmly to Qin Mingxu, “You should go back quickly.”

“And you?” Qin Mingxu asked.

“I, of course, will do what I must. Tell Elder Sister I am safe, that will be enough.”

Qin Mingxu nodded and stumbled down the mountain.

Feng Gao returned to the mountain stronghold.

The matter of Recruit and Pacify was not yet finished; his task was not yet complete.

The sky, unknowingly, brightened.

The night had passed just like that.

The blood on the ground soaked the grass and trees.

The grass and trees swayed in the breaking dawn light.

The cold sky, the sparse red leaves.

The empty greenness dampens one’s clothes.

All sounds faded into silence. Only the roosting birds, the chirping insects, the arriving and departing geese had witnessed so many entanglements, so many thoughts, so much complexity, so many sighs.

In my light sleep, I felt a pair of hands stroking my hair.

I opened my eyes and saw Qin Mingxu had returned.

It had been a long time since he had slept in the bedroom since we started sleeping in separate beds.

I quickly sat up: “Mingxu, how is the situation now?”

He embraced me and said, “It’s alright. Sang Yu, don’t be nervous, you might injure the fetus.”

I touched my belly and said, “The doctor said the pregnancy is stable, it’s nothing. I suppose this Child will be a very strong Child.”

I asked again, “Where is Dou Ya? Why didn’t she come back with you?”

He said softly, “Director Feng said he would come down the mountain after finishing the Recruit and Pacify matter.”

I thought for a moment and said, “That’s fine. Has the Zou Cheng situation been resolved?”

He said, “It’s resolved. Don’t worry.”

“Sang Yu, every time we go through danger together, I worry I won’t see you again.” He held me even tighter.

I smelled the scent of blood on him and remembered how he had risked everything for me. It seemed that all the hardships had been filled with soft willow catkins.

I pointed at the sleeping Cherry and said, “Mingxu, her name is Cherry. From now on, she is our daughter.”

“Okay,” Qin Mingxu said.

He didn’t even ask about Cherry’s identity or origin. If I said she was our daughter, then she was.

The single word “Okay” conveyed a thousand emotions, full of love.

“Mingxu,” I called him.

In this marriage, he had given me immense care and affection, leaving me no longer tormented by incomprehensible anxieties. He had fulfilled the promise he made by the riverbank. Always trust. Never suspect.

As a Husband, he was dutiful.

As a lover, he gave his all.

How could I not treat him with all my heart?

“Mingxu, stay here tonight. Sleep with me and Cherry, okay?” I gently rubbed my forehead against his stubbled chin.

In the past, I had never shown such innocent affection in front of him.

He lay down and said tenderly, “Okay.”

The resentment in his eyes gradually dissipated.

It was as if white clouds rose in a mirror, and the bright moon descended before the steps.

【Farming and Business + Marriage of Convenience + Angsty Love 】《Zhaoyang Hall》 Another angsty ancient romance by author Mianhua Hua, only seeking a good match to live a stable life. This is the tumultuous and tragic life of a merchant's daughter in the Ming Dynasty, and also the ordinary, mundane, and fiery human world of every common person. During the Wanli era, Zhu Sangyu, the daughter of a merchant in Dongchang, was driven out by her father and stepmother. Holding her marriage certificate, she went to the Cheng Residence in Yangzhou Prefecture to get married, where she met the three most important men in her life. Her fiancé, Cheng Huaishi, is a man praised by all, but his choices destined him not to give her a stable life. The wealthy young master Qin Mingxu is her true love; they missed each other due to a twist of fate, losing a lifetime together. The eunuch Feng Gao is a villain despised by everyone, yet he is the relative she cares about the most. Sangyu is not late, Ning Yue is like the wind. She experienced one farewell after another. Having walked through swords and shadows, and through separation and death, the stability she desired, like the dawn at the end of a long and arduous night, was finally obtained. In the rolling red dust, peace is all that matters.
